0

这是我的代码

import MultiCarousel from "react-multi-carousel";
import { ImageBackground, Text, View } from 'react-native';
import { styles } from '../components/Styles';

const HomeScreen = props => {
    
    return (
        <View style={styles.container}>
            <View style={styles.carouselCategoryParent}>
                        <MultiCarousel responsive={responsive}>
                            <div>Item 1</div>
                            <div>Item 2</div>
                            <div>Item 3</div>
                            <div>Item 4</div>
                        </MultiCarousel>;
               </View>
        </View>
    );
}
export default HomeScreen;

这是我在代码中遇到的错误;


Error: Text strings must be rendered within a <Text> component.

This error is located at: 
in RCTView (at View.js:34)
in View (at HomeScreen.js:61)
in RCTView (at View.js:34)
in View (at HomeScreen.js:46)

这是我到目前为止尝试过的,希望得到一些解决方案

4

1 回答 1

2

只需删除“;” 在结束标记之后</MultiCarousel>并更改<div><View>. <div>不是 React Native 中的有效元素。

于 2021-03-12T15:31:33.123 回答